Rick Owens’ latest Berlin event has caused heated debate online. The American fashion designer recently opened a store in Berlin and launched the 12th flagship store with a fashion show. However, the event has caused significant public outrage as netizens criticized some of the models, claiming it evoked the imagery of slavery.

In clips circulating online, shirtless black models can be seen serving drinks to the attendees of the fashion event.

One X user @realestherchucks tweeted:

“The white people are wearing the black outfit while the blacks are bare naked serving drinks..... the story the creative director is telling was so loud that everyone could hear it.”

While many netizens condemn Rick’s style, long-time supporters of the American designer say it was just a bold expression of Rick’s extreme style. They also pointed out that white models were shirtless and serving drinks.


More details on Rick Owens’ Berlin fashion event

On September 26, 2025, Rick Owens announced on Instagram that he had opened his 12th flagship store in Berlin. He wrote:

"LIKE A LOT OF PEOPLE, MY FIRST PERCEPTIONS OF BERLIN AS A TEEN JUST STARTING TO MAKE AESTHETIC CHOICES, WERE MARLENE DIETRICH AND HANSA STUDIOS, WHERE BOWIE RECORDED HEROES AND MIXED IGGY'S THE IDIOT. AND I NEVER REALLY MOVED ON FROM THERE. BLEAKNESS AND GLAMOUR, FEAR AND FATALISM, DISCIPLINE AND COLLAPSE, RIGOUR AND ROMANCE, FASSBINDER AND CHRISTIANE F. GLITTERING DOOM.”

He added:

“THIS IS STILL ALL I EVER THINK ABOUT. OFFENSIVELY REDUCTIVE? I KNOW THERE IS SO MUCH MORE TO BERLIN, BUT THIS IS MY OWN PERSONAL LITTLE BREATHLESSLY DELUSIONAL TAKEAWAY. AND NOW I CAN'T BELIEVE WE'RE OPENING A STORE HERE. AND WHEN I FIRST LOOKED AT THE SPACE I ASKED MYSELF, WHAT WOULD BEUYS DO? I HOPE YOU LIKE IT...”

On October 26, the designer hosted a fashion show in his Berlin store to celebrate the publication of his book Rick Owens, Temple of Love. He announced on Instagram:
